We are all aspects of the Divine, of God, of Spirit, of Global Oneness - so what can those in the public eye show us and reflect back to us? In this show, we'll look at the astrological profiles of Brad Pitt, Angelina Jolie, Hillary Clinton, and Donald Trump through the lens of soul growth and consciousness. Each person is a major player on the world stage, and their truth exists in their astrology chart.
